The Minnesota Vikings came up short against the Tennessee Titans on the road in the team's final preseason game. The 13-23 loss wasn't a complete loss for the purple and gold, since there were some things to be happy about.
The Titans played many of their starters on Friday, with the Vikings opting to sit their first team. Despite that, Minnesota had a competitive exhibition against Tennessee, which started No. 1 overall pick Cam Ward at quarterback.
The loss means the Vikings will finish the preseason 1-3 with limited playing time for their starters. Fans will get a much better look at the team when they go to Chicago to take on the Bears in Week 1 of the regular season on Monday Night Football.
